"Goddes Visitacion": Human Suffering and Divine Agency in Calvin and Herbert
In this article, I put John Calvin and George Herbert in conversation on the theological question of God's role in human suffering. For Calvin, God's providence implies that God actively wills all things that occur, including suffering, and that consolation comes from this acknowledgement....
